[Severity: High]
This is a pre-existing issue, but does using regmap_clear_bits() here cause
lock nesting violations on real-time systems? 

The interrupt core calls airoha_irq_mask() with a raw spinlock held. Because 
pinctrl->regmap is a syscon regmap, it does not use raw spinlocks by default.
This means it becomes a sleeping lock on real-time kernels.

Acquiring a sleeping lock while holding a raw spinlock can lead to a panic.

> +	gpiochip_disable_irq(gc, irqd_to_hwirq(data));

[Severity: High]
Does calling gpiochip_disable_irq() here remove output protection during
level-triggered interrupt handling?

When the irq core handles level-triggered interrupts, it temporarily masks
the interrupt by calling airoha_irq_mask() during handler execution. Since
gpiochip_disable_irq() is placed here, the GPIOD_FLAG_IRQ_IS_ENABLED bit is
cleared.

This would allow a concurrent call to gpiod_direction_output() to succeed
and mistakenly reconfigure the active interrupt pin as an output. Should
these calls be placed in dedicated .irq_enable and .irq_disable callbacks
instead?

[Severity: High]
This is a pre-existing issue, but does the driver fail to handle
level-triggered interrupts properly?

In airoha_pinctrl_add_gpiochip(), the handler is set to handle_simple_irq:

    girq->handler = handle_simple_irq;

However, airoha_irq_type() doesn't call irq_set_handler_locked() to upgrade
the handler to handle_level_irq for level triggers. Since handle_simple_irq
does not mask the interrupt before executing a threaded handler, will the
unhandled hardware interrupt loop infinitely and cause an interrupt storm?

[Severity: High]
This is a pre-existing issue, but can edge-triggered interrupts be lost due
to the status clearing order?

In airoha_irq_handler(), the code clears the hardware status register after
executing the child interrupt handler:

    generic_handle_irq(irq_find_mapping(girq->domain, offset));
    regmap_write(pinctrl->regmap, pinctrl->gpiochip.status[i], BIT(irq));

If a new edge interrupt occurs for the same pin while the child handler is
running, the hardware latches the new edge. Will the subsequent
write-1-to-clear operation unconditionally clear the status bit and erase the
newly latched edge without it being processed?

[Severity: High]
This is a pre-existing issue, but is there a risk of a use-after-free or
null pointer dereference during teardown or early probe?

In airoha_pinctrl_add_gpiochip(), the shared interrupt is requested before
the gpiochip is added:

    err = devm_request_irq(dev, irq, airoha_irq_handler, IRQF_SHARED,
                           dev_name(dev), pinctrl);

During driver removal, devm_gpiochip_add_data() unwinds first and destroys
the irq domain. The shared interrupt remains active until
devm_request_irq() unwinds.

If an interrupt fires during this window, airoha_irq_handler() will
dereference the freed girq->domain.
